Comprehending the Demolition Refine
Demolition begins with cautious preparation and assessment of the site. This preliminary action is important, as it entails determining the framework's condition, surrounding atmosphere, and any kind of potential risks. Specialists conduct complete inspections to identify the products made use of in construction, particularly harmful substances like asbestos or lead. When the analysis is full, the group develops a comprehensive demolition strategy that details the approaches and tools required for the job.
Next off, the group assurances safety and security measures remain in area, consisting of safeguarding the area and informing surrounding homes. The actual demolition may make use of different techniques, such as mechanical demolition or deconstruction, relying on the framework and its area. Throughout the procedure, waste administration techniques are executed to decrease and reuse materials landfill use. Recognizing these actions is necessary for verifying that the demolition is performed efficiently and securely, sticking to industry standards and neighborhood guidelines.

Safety Considerations for Demolition
Demolition tasks can transform a home, they also posture considerable safety risks that have to be very carefully handled. Proper preparation is vital, beginning with a thorough assessment of the site to recognize potential threats such as unsteady structures or the visibility of dangerous products like asbestos. Workers need to be geared up with appropriate individual protective devices (PPE), including difficult hats, gloves, and breathing protection.
Developing a clear safety procedure is vital. This includes safeguarding the demolition area to stop unauthorized accessibility and ensuring that all workers are educated in security treatments. Equipment utilized throughout demolition, such as excavators and jackhammers, need to be run by qualified specialists to minimize mishaps. In addition, clear interaction among employee can aid in rapidly attending to any kind of unexpected risks that might emerge. By prioritizing security procedures, the threats associated with demolition can be noticeably lowered, creating a safer workplace for every person entailed.
Ecological Impact and Sustainability
As urban advancement remains to increase, the ecological influence of residence and garage demolition in Denver, CO, comes to be significantly significant. Demolition activities typically cause substantial waste generation, with building and construction and demolition particles accounting for a substantial portion of landfill contributions. This waste can include hazardous materials, such as asbestos and lead, posing risks to both the environment and public health if not managed properly.
Additionally, the carbon footprint connected with demolition procedures, specifically via equipment and transport, increases worries regarding sustainability. In order to reduce these effects, many demolition professionals are now taking on eco-friendly practices such as reusing and reusing materials whenever feasible. This not just minimizes garbage dump waste but also preserves natural deposits. Incorporating sustainable demolition methods can advertise compliance with neighborhood policies aimed at decreasing environmental injury. Generally, addressing the ecological impact of demolition is essential for promoting lasting metropolitan development in Denver.

Post-Demolition Clean-up and Site Prep Work
After picking a qualified demolition professional, attention transforms to the necessary phase of post-demolition cleanup and website preparation. This stage is essential for assuring the site is risk-free and ready for future construction or landscape design. Cleanup entails the elimination of debris, hazardous products, and any type of staying structural aspects from the demolished residence and garage. Appropriate disposal methods have to be followed to abide by local laws, including reusing materials whenever feasible.
Once the location is cleared, website preparation begins. This consists of grading the land to assure proper drain and leveling the ground for any future projects. Soil screening may likewise be conducted to evaluate its stability for new building and construction. Additionally, any type of essential permits must be secured before beginning more work. For how long Does a Regular Demolition Task Take?
A regular demolition task normally takes in between one to 2 weeks, relying on the dimension and intricacy of the framework, regional guidelines, and possible ecological factors to consider that may require extra time for security and compliance.
What Materials Are Commonly Recycled Throughout Demolition?
Generally recycled products throughout demolition include concrete, metal, wood, blocks, and glass. These products can be repurposed or refined for reuse, decreasing waste and promoting sustainability in construction and renovation tasks.

Are There Details Insurance Coverage Requirements for Demolition Projects?
Yes, details insurance coverage requirements for demolition projects commonly consist of liability insurance coverage, employees' compensation, and ecological insurance coverage. These protect versus potential injuries, building damages, and environmental threats, making sure compliance with neighborhood policies and guarding all celebrations entailed.
What Happens to Energies Throughout the Demolition Refine?
Throughout the demolition process, energies are generally shut down to guarantee safety and security. This involves detaching gas, water, and electrical energy, preventing risks like leakages or fires, and allowing for a safe setting for the demolition crew.
